Anje is a feminine name derived from the Hebrew name 'Anna,' which means 'grace' or 'favor.' Rooted in biblical tradition, it symbolizes kindness and mercy, often associated with divine grace. Historically, variants of this name have been popular in various cultures, especially in Slavic and Scandinavian regions, adapting in pronunciation and spelling while maintaining its core significance.

Cultural Significance of Anje

The name Anje, closely related to Anna and Anja, holds a rich cultural significance in Slavic, Scandinavian, and Hebrew traditions. It often symbolizes grace and mercy, qualities revered in many religious and social contexts. Historically, the variants have been borne by saints, queens, and notable women, embedding the name with a sense of dignity and spiritual depth.
